Cornyn Primary Tops First 2026 Contests
Tax writers will star in the first primaries of the midterm elections determining control of Congress next year.
Sen John Cornyn’s (R-Texas) quest for a fifth term has top billing as he faces the prospect of a runoff election for renomination.
Cornyn, a member of the Senate Finance Committee, in TV advertising has leaned on his authorship of legislation (S. 3554) to allow the Treasury Department to revoke the tax-exempt status of organizations it deems support terrorist groups.
